Boc-D-Asp(OBzl)-OH

Base Information Edit
  • Chemical Name:Boc-D-Asp(OBzl)-OH
  • CAS No.:51186-58-4
  • Molecular Formula:C16H21NO6
  • Molecular Weight:323.346
  • Hs Code.:2924 29 70
  • UNII:JPD6M53HLN
  • Nikkaji Number:J454.219C

Chemical Property of Boc-D-Asp(OBzl)-OH Edit
Chemical Property:
  • Boiling Point:508.1 °C at 760 mmHg 
  • PKA:3.65±0.23(Predicted) 
  • Flash Point:261.1 °C 
  • PSA:101.93000 
  • Density:1.219 g/cm3 
  • LogP:2.48870 
  • Storage Temp.:Store at 0-5°C 
  • XLogP3:1.9
  • Hydrogen Bond Donor Count:2
  • Hydrogen Bond Acceptor Count:6
  • Rotatable Bond Count:9
  • Exact Mass:323.13688739
  • Heavy Atom Count:23
  • Complexity:423

  • Canonical SMILES:CC(C)(C)OC(=O)NC(CC(=O)OCC1=CC=CC=C1)C(=O)O
  • Isomeric SMILES:CC(C)(C)OC(=O)N[C@H](CC(=O)OCC1=CC=CC=C1)C(=O)O
  • Uses N-Boc-D-aspartic acid 4-benzyl ester is used as an intermediate in organic synthesis and pharmaceuticals.
